I just got my FZ6 on Monday. I have rode it about 120 miles so far. I noticed today that it sounds different in neutral. It is hard to explain the noise it is making. But when I pull the clutch in it stops making the noise. It is just a little louder until I pull the clutch in then it stops. Any ideas what it may be or is it normal?

I haven't listened for it myself, but it's probably normal.

When you're in neutral with the clutch out, some parts of the transmission are still turning.

When you pull in the clutch, those parts stop turning.
